Early careers recruitment co-ordinator

Preston (Lancashire)
Permanent
Page Personnel
Posted: 30 September
Offer description

1. Excellent Company Benefits
2. Hybrid Working Policy and can be based in Preston or Manchester office

About Our Client

This professional services firm operates as a medium-sized organisation with a strong focus on delivering high-quality services to clients. The company has a national presence backed by the strength and global reach of an international network. With the combination of local knowledge and international resources giving clients the very best level of service

Job Description

3. Manage interview schedules and communications for candidates, and stakeholders across the business groups, providing an excellent experience to everyone you work with daily
4. Lead Assessment Centres
5. Deliver careers outreach activities in local and educational settings
6. Work alongside the HR team to initiate offer letters
7. Manage onboarding processes such as the right to work process, triggering actions and ensuring on-time completion of key milestones
8. Consider how processes can be improved and make recommendations to enhance service provision

The Successful Applicant

A successful Early Careers Recruitment Co-Ordinator should have:

9. Previous experience as a recruitment co-ordinator, experience with event management, such as assessment centres
10. Strong time management abilities, extremely organised and detail orientated
11. Strong written and verbal communications skills, displaying professionalism
12. Take accountability and ownership to achieve outcomes
13. 1 -3 years of recruitment administrative support experience
14. Experience communicating (written and verbal) effectively and tactfully in a professional services environment
15. Strong interpersonal skills in dealing with all levels of management

What's on Offer

16. A competitive salary of approximately £28,000 to £32,000 per year.
17. Agile Working: Enjoy the flexibility of core hours from 10 AM to 2 PM and two home working days, allowing you to balance your work and personal commitments seamlessly.
18. 33 days including public holidays. You will also have the opportunity to buy or sell up to 5 days.
19. Competitive salary package
20. Employee recognition awards: Outstanding Performance Award Bonus and other recognition initiatives.
21. New and improved programme for succession planning and supportive management structure to help you realise your potential
22. Employee Assistance Programme: Access a free confidential 24-hour support service, including unlimited counselling sessions and virtual doctors available for you and your family.
